Powertrain Performance and Hybrid Integration
The 2026 Lincoln Nautilus® offers two sophisticated powertrain options engineered for both performance and efficiency. The standard configuration features a 2.0-liter turbocharged inline-four engine paired with an eight-speed automatic transmission, producing approximately 250 horsepower and 280 lb-ft of torque. This setup delivers smooth acceleration and precise throttle response. Drivers benefit from improved low-end torque and reduced turbo lag through enhanced turbocharger calibration.
For drivers seeking greater efficiency, the available 2.0-liter hybrid powertrain combines the turbocharged engine with a continuously variable transmission (CVT) and an electric motor, generating an estimated 285 horsepower. This configuration provides quiet transitions between electric and gas propulsion and supports regenerative braking for energy recovery during deceleration. The system automatically manages energy distribution between the engine and electric motor for balanced performance, allowing extended driving range and reduced fuel consumption.
All-wheel drive comes standard on every 2026 Lincoln Nautilus®, optimizing traction across a range of driving conditions. The intelligent AWD system continually monitors road surfaces, redistributing torque between the front and rear wheels for greater stability.

Advanced Driver Assistance and Control Systems
The 2026 Lincoln Nautilus® incorporates the latest Lincoln Co-Pilot360™ 2.0, designed to assist with monitoring, braking, and steering precision. The Pre-Collision Assist system detects vehicles and pedestrians, applying braking automatically to mitigate or avoid impact.
The vehicle’s Blind Spot Information System (BLIS®) provides warnings of approaching vehicles, while Cross-Traffic Alert monitors side zones during reversing maneuvers. Adaptive Cruise Control manages distance and speed with stop-and-go capability, automatically resuming motion after brief stops in traffic.
One of the key innovations is Lincoln BlueCruise®, which allows hands-free driving on compatible highways. Using adaptive cruise control, lane-centering technology, and forward-facing cameras, BlueCruise® enables the vehicle to maintain lane position and speed without manual steering input. The system updates regularly via software improvements and includes enhanced driver monitoring to ensure alertness.
Supporting these features are Adaptive Pixel LED Headlamps that automatically adjust illumination intensity and spread, improving visibility without creating glare for oncoming traffic. The 360-degree camera system offers multiple viewing angles for parking and low-speed maneuvering, with high-resolution imaging integrated into the central display.
Suspension, Steering, and Ride Dynamics
The 2026 Lincoln Nautilus® employs an independent front suspension system with coil springs and a stabilizer bar and Continuous Control Damping shock. And for the rear suspension, the independent SLA suspension with lateral semi-trailing arms, stabilizer bar, coil springs, and mono-tube gas shocks. Isolated rear subframe bushings reduce noise and vibration.
The Electric Power-Assisted Steering (EPAS) provides variable assistance depending on vehicle speed and cornering force. At lower speeds, the steering system delivers lighter input for ease of maneuverability, while at highway speeds it increases resistance for stability. Combined with the precise chassis geometry, this setup ensures predictable handling across varying driving environments.
Ride comfort is further enhanced by a low center of gravity achieved through the hybrid battery’s underfloor placement. This configuration improves balance, contributes to reduced body roll, and enhances cabin stability during acceleration and braking.

Energy Efficiency and Power Management
The hybrid system’s regenerative braking captures kinetic energy during deceleration, converting it to electrical energy stored in the high-capacity lithium-ion battery. This energy is later used to supplement engine output, improving fuel economy and reducing emissions. The battery cooling system regulates temperature across varying loads, ensuring sustained performance and extending component life.
The automatic start-stop feature operates seamlessly to reduce idle emissions and conserve energy. When the vehicle comes to a stop, the engine shuts down, restarting instantly when the accelerator is pressed. This transition is calibrated to occur without vibration or delay, preserving driver comfort.
Energy data can be viewed through the vehicle’s digital interface, displaying consumption rates, charge recovery, and hybrid efficiency indicators. Drivers gain a comprehensive understanding of the vehicle’s power distribution at all times.
Integrated Technology for Driving Precision
The 2026 Lincoln Nautilus® introduces an advanced suite of digital integrations to support accuracy in operation. The Lincoln Drive Modes system enables selection among settings such as Normal, Conserve, Excite, Slippery, and Deep Conditions. Each mode modifies throttle sensitivity, suspension stiffness, and torque distribution to optimize response to terrain and conditions.
The braking system uses electronic brake force distribution to balance front and rear pressure based on vehicle load and driving inputs. In hybrid models, regenerative braking blends with hydraulic braking for smooth pedal response.
A suite of embedded sensors communicates continuously between drivetrain and stability systems, allowing predictive adjustments before traction loss occurs. The integration of mechanical and digital feedback creates a consistent and composed driving experience across all conditions.
